The journey to Muktinath can be both serene and adventurous. The scenic drive from Jomsom to Muktinath is mesmerizing. The road follows the Kali Gandaki River, flanked by towering peaks. Travelers witness a dramatic transition from lush green valleys to arid, high-altitude deserts. The road conditions are unpaved and challenging, especially between Jomsom and Muktinath.

Be prepared for a bumpy ride.

Day 7 : SIDDHARTHA NAGAR TO AYODHYA (180KMS/6HRS)

As we bid farewell to the serene landscapes of Siddharthnagar, Nepal, our journey takes an exciting turn. Our destination: the sacred city of Ayodhya in Uttar Pradesh, India. The Sunauli border serves as our gateway from Nepal to India. This bustling crossing point connects Bhairahawa in Nepal to Gorakhpur in India. As we approach the border, the anticipation grows. The open border system, maintained by both countries, ensures a seamless transition.

Our journey continues through the heart of Uttar Pradesh. The road winds past villages, fields, and towns. As we approach Ayodhya, the city’s ancient temples and ghats beckon us.
